Automating link-local IPv4 (APIPA, 169.254.x.x) management typically involves network monitoring tools that flag devices falling back to link-local addresses, which usually indicates DHCP failures. Tools like SolarWinds IPAM, ManageEngine OpUtils, or Cisco DNA Center can be configured to alert on APIPA assignments and trigger automated remediation workflows via APIs or scripts. For distributed teams, integrating these tools with your IT service management (ITSM) platform and using network automation frameworks like Ansible or Terraform can streamline response across sites.
